
进行天气数据的可行性分析,需要明确数据来源、数据准确性、数据处理方法、数据应用场景等几个方面,其中明确数据来源是关键的一步。明确数据来源是保证数据可靠性的基础,可以通过国家气象局、专业气象服务公司、开源气象数据平台等多种渠道获取。国家气象局的数据通常具有较高的权威性和准确性,适用于需要高精度数据的分析项目。接下来,详细描述数据来源的选择及其重要性。
一、明确数据来源
明确数据来源是进行天气数据可行性分析的首要任务。数据来源的选择直接影响到数据的可信度和分析结果的准确性。选择数据来源时,可以考虑以下几个方面:
- 权威性:选择权威的气象机构或数据提供商,例如国家气象局或专业气象服务公司。这些机构通常具有专业的设备和技术,能够提供高精度的数据。
- 覆盖范围:根据分析需求,选择覆盖范围合适的数据来源。如果需要全球范围的数据,可以选择像NOAA(美国国家海洋和大气管理局)这样的国际机构。
- 数据类型:根据分析需求,选择提供所需数据类型的来源。例如,如果需要历史天气数据,可以选择提供长期数据记录的来源。
- 数据更新频率:根据实时性需求,选择数据更新频率合适的来源。如果需要实时数据,可以选择提供高频率更新的来源。
二、数据准确性
数据准确性是天气数据分析的关键。确保数据准确性需要考虑以下几个方面:
- 数据采集方法:了解数据是如何采集的,例如使用的仪器、采集频率等。高精度的仪器和高频率的采集可以提高数据的准确性。
- 数据清洗与校准:在使用数据前,需要进行数据清洗和校准,去除异常值和错误数据。可以使用统计方法或机器学习算法来识别和处理异常值。
- 数据验证:将数据与其他权威数据源进行对比验证,确保数据的准确性。例如,可以将采集的数据与国家气象局的数据进行对比,验证其准确性。
三、数据处理方法
数据处理方法是天气数据分析的重要环节。处理方法的选择影响到分析结果的准确性和有效性。可以考虑以下几个方面:
- 数据预处理:对原始数据进行预处理,例如去除缺失值、异常值处理、数据标准化等。预处理可以提高数据的质量,为后续分析打下基础。
- 数据转换:根据分析需求,将数据转换为合适的格式。例如,可以将时间序列数据转换为统计特征数据,便于进行分析。
- 数据聚合:对数据进行聚合,例如按时间段、地理区域等进行汇总。聚合后的数据可以更加清晰地展示整体趋势和规律。
- 数据可视化:使用图表、地图等可视化手段展示数据,帮助更好地理解和分析数据。例如,可以使用折线图展示温度变化趋势,使用热力图展示降水分布情况。
四、数据应用场景
天气数据有广泛的应用场景,可以根据分析目标选择合适的应用场景。以下是一些常见的应用场景:
- 气象预测:利用历史天气数据和实时数据,进行天气预测。例如,可以使用机器学习算法构建预测模型,预测未来几天的天气情况。
- 农业生产:天气数据对农业生产具有重要影响。例如,可以利用天气数据预测作物生长情况、病虫害风险等,指导农业生产活动。
- 交通管理:天气对交通安全和效率有重要影响。例如,可以利用天气数据预测道路湿滑情况、能见度等,进行交通管理和预警。
- 能源管理:天气对能源需求和供给有重要影响。例如,可以利用天气数据预测电力需求、风能和太阳能发电量等,进行能源管理和调度。
- 环境保护:天气数据对环境保护具有重要参考价值。例如,可以利用天气数据预测空气质量变化、污染物扩散情况等,进行环境保护和治理。
五、数据分析工具
选择合适的数据分析工具可以提高分析效率和准确性。以下是几种常见的数据分析工具:
- Python:Python是一种常用的数据分析编程语言,具有丰富的数据处理和分析库,例如Pandas、NumPy、SciPy等。Python还具有强大的可视化库,例如Matplotlib、Seaborn等。
- R:R是一种专门用于统计分析和数据可视化的编程语言,具有丰富的数据处理和分析包,例如dplyr、ggplot2等。R还具有强大的统计建模和机器学习能力。
- Excel:Excel是一种常用的数据处理和分析工具,适用于处理中小规模的数据。Excel具有丰富的函数和图表功能,可以进行基本的数据处理和分析。
- FineBI:FineBI是帆软旗下的一款商业智能工具,具有强大的数据处理和分析能力。FineBI支持多种数据源接入,具有丰富的数据可视化功能,可以进行深入的数据分析和展示。FineBI官网: https://s.fanruan.com/f459r;
- Tableau:Tableau是一种强大的数据可视化工具,适用于处理大规模的数据。Tableau具有丰富的图表和仪表盘功能,可以进行交互式的数据分析和展示。
六、数据分析方法
选择合适的数据分析方法可以提高分析结果的准确性和有效性。以下是几种常见的数据分析方法:
- 描述性统计:描述性统计用于总结和描述数据的基本特征。例如,可以计算平均值、中位数、标准差等,了解数据的集中趋势和离散程度。
- 时间序列分析:时间序列分析用于分析时间序列数据的趋势和规律。例如,可以使用移动平均、指数平滑等方法,分析温度、降水量等的变化趋势。
- 回归分析:回归分析用于研究变量之间的关系。例如,可以使用线性回归、多元回归等方法,分析温度、湿度、风速等对降水量的影响。
- 聚类分析:聚类分析用于将数据分为多个类别,寻找数据的内在结构。例如,可以使用K-means、层次聚类等方法,分析不同地区的天气模式。
- 分类分析:分类分析用于将数据分为不同的类别,进行分类预测。例如,可以使用决策树、随机森林等方法,预测天气情况的类别。
- 机器学习:机器学习用于构建数据驱动的预测模型。例如,可以使用支持向量机、神经网络等方法,构建天气预测模型。
七、数据分析案例
通过实际案例可以更好地理解和掌握天气数据的分析方法。以下是一个天气数据分析的案例:
- 案例背景:某农业公司希望利用天气数据预测未来几天的降水量,以指导农业生产活动。
- 数据收集:从国家气象局获取过去10年的历史天气数据,包括温度、湿度、风速、降水量等。
- 数据预处理:对数据进行预处理,去除缺失值和异常值,进行数据标准化。
- 数据分析:使用时间序列分析方法,分析降水量的变化趋势。使用回归分析方法,研究温度、湿度、风速等对降水量的影响。
- 模型构建:使用机器学习方法,构建降水量预测模型。将数据分为训练集和测试集,使用支持向量机进行模型训练和验证。
- 结果分析:分析模型的预测结果,评估模型的准确性和有效性。根据预测结果,提出农业生产的建议和措施。
八、数据可视化展示
数据可视化是展示分析结果的重要手段,可以帮助更好地理解和解释数据。以下是几种常见的数据可视化方法:
- 折线图:折线图用于展示时间序列数据的变化趋势。例如,可以使用折线图展示温度、降水量等的变化趋势。
- 柱状图:柱状图用于展示数据的分布情况。例如,可以使用柱状图展示不同月份的降水量分布情况。
- 散点图:散点图用于展示变量之间的关系。例如,可以使用散点图展示温度和降水量之间的关系。
- 热力图:热力图用于展示数据的空间分布情况。例如,可以使用热力图展示不同地区的降水量分布情况。
- 地图:地图用于展示地理数据。例如,可以使用地图展示不同地区的天气情况。
通过以上几个方面的分析,可以全面了解和掌握天气数据的可行性分析方法,确保数据分析的准确性和有效性,为实际应用提供有力支持。
相关问答FAQs:
天气数据可行性分析的目的是什么?
天气数据可行性分析主要旨在评估特定项目或研究中使用天气数据的可行性及其潜在影响。通过分析天气数据,研究人员和决策者可以了解天气条件对农业、交通、建筑、能源等行业的影响。这一过程通常包括对历史天气数据的分析、对数据来源的评估以及对数据准确性和可靠性的验证。通过这些分析,决策者能够制定更加科学合理的决策,降低风险,并最大化资源的利用效率。
在进行天气数据可行性分析时需要考虑哪些因素?
在进行天气数据可行性分析时,需要考虑多个因素,包括数据的来源、数据的时效性、数据的准确性和完整性、以及数据的适用性。数据来源方面,应优先选择权威机构提供的数据,例如国家气象局、气象卫星等。时效性是指数据是否能反映当前的天气状况,特别是在快速变化的环境中。数据的准确性和完整性也非常重要,误差较大的数据可能导致错误的结论。此外,数据的适用性也需考虑,确保所使用的天气数据与研究目标和范围相匹配。
如何收集和分析天气数据以支持可行性分析?
收集和分析天气数据的过程可以分为几个步骤。首先,确定所需的数据类型,包括温度、降水量、湿度、风速等。接着,选择合适的数据来源,常见的包括气象局、气象网站、气象API等。然后,进行数据收集,确保数据的时间范围和空间范围符合研究要求。
在收集到数据后,需要对数据进行预处理,包括去除异常值、填补缺失值等。接下来,使用统计分析工具对数据进行分析,识别趋势、季节性变化和极端天气事件。通过图表、模型和其他可视化工具,研究人员可以更直观地展示分析结果,帮助决策者理解天气数据对项目的影响。最后,撰写报告,详细说明数据收集、分析方法以及得出的结论,为决策提供依据。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。



